What makes you happy

      A Chinese philosopher Ching Chow said: “Happiness is the place between too little and too much. ”  Of course, different people need different things to be happy. Falling in love, getting mail, having the best time,  an unexpected present can make one category of people happy, while others feel fantastic making the winning score, seeing a falling star, hitting the lottery or solving a serious problem. Even simple pleasures such as decorating a Christmas tree, eating pizza or singing and dancing never leave many people indifferent. And what about pupils and teachers? What are the things which can make them happy?

Can people be made happy?

There’s the side in human’s happiness problem, connected with the relationship between people. Some people want to be happy and make the conditions for it. But some people, thinking about their personal happiness try to make happy other people and make happy the whole world. Didro; “ The happiest person is the person who gives happiness to the great amount of people.”

How far is it justified to give happiness to people? Another question is do people want to be made happy? Is there any affect of uninvited savior, benefactor? Who asked such people make the other happy? If they reject themselves and ready to sacrifice their happiness, how can they understand what the other people want? Person, who didn’t feel happiness – has just theoretical imagination about what happiness is. But theoretical happiness can differ from real happiness.

Strivings for making the other people happy is dangerous utopia. Nobody can make anyone happy. Happiness is highly individual category. It means that only human himself happy. He is the subject of the happiness or misfortune. People can be made wealthy, they can be given food, shelter, etc. But the person can’t be made happy. When parents think they can make their children happy, they are wrong. It’s mistaken for husbands and wives to think that they made happy each other. And politicians who think they make happy the whole world are wrong too.
